Gas Gains
Nov 10, 2013 (LBO) – Profits at Sri Lanka’s Laugfs Gas rose 50 percent to 619 million rupees in the September 2013 quarter from a year earlier, amid easing commodity prices, interim accounts showed. Property and leisure units were in losses. The group reported earnings of 1.60 rupees per share. For the 6-months to September […]

Sri Lanka inflation at 6.7-pct in October
Oct 31, 2013 (LBO) – Sri Lanka’s consumer prices rose 6.7 percent in October 2013 from a year earlier, accelerating from 6.2 percent in September, the state statistics office said. Sri Lanka’s Colombo Consumer Price Index rose 0.2 percent in the month to 176.1 points in the month. Sri Lanka’s inflation has been stable for […]
